private void comboBoxSkill_SelectedIndexChanged(object sender, EventArgs e) { this.listBoxAssociatedSkills.Items.Clear(); foreach (DataRow row in DataController.GetSkills().getSubSkillsTable(this.comboBoxSkill.SelectedItem.ToString()).Tables[0].Rows) { this.listBoxAssociatedSkills.Items.Add(row[0]); } }
private void buttonAddEvidence_Click(object sender, EventArgs e) { string evidenceName = this.textBoxEvidenceName.Text; int skillId = DataController.GetSkills().getSkillID(this.comboBoxSkill.SelectedItem.ToString()); string[] names = this.comboBoxUser.SelectedItem.ToString().Split(' '); int userId = DataController.GetUserTable().GetUserID(names[0], names[1]); string description = this.descriptionTextBox.Text; DataController.GetEvidence().createEvidence(evidenceName, skillId, userId, description); if (us != null) { us.refreshTable(); } if (ue != null) { ue.refreshTable(); } this.Close(); }